Honey Peach Barbecued Ribs recipe

Serves: 6-8
 
Rubbed with sweet and smoky seasoning then slathered with a peach barbecue sauce, these ribs are sure to be a hit at your next BBQ!
Ingredients
  • 2 large fresh ripe peaches, pitted and chopped (with skins)
  • 1 Tbs fresh rosemary
  • 1 Tbs brown sugar
  • ½ - 1 tsp nutmeg
  • 1 cup Kraft Honey Barbecue Sauce
  • 2 - 4 Tbs McCormick Grill Mates Sweet & Smoky Rub
  • 2 slabs Tyson Pork Spare ribs (about 6 - 8 lbs total)

Instructions
For Barbecue sauce:
  1. Place first five ingredients into a blender and puree until smooth. Keep in the fridge until ready to slather your ribs.
To Grill Ribs:
  1. If you're using a Firespice pack, place it on grill. Preheat grill for high heat.
  2. Trim the membrane from the back of rib rack by running a small, sharp knife between the membrane and end rib, peel back the membrane and discard.
  3. Using two tablespoons per rack, sprinkle the McCormick Sweet & Smoky rub onto both sides of the ribs to coat.
  4. Place ribs, meat side up, onto a rib grill rack over a sheet of aluminum foil. (or place on top grill rack with aluminum foil on bottom grate to catch grease).
  5. Reduce heat to low and let ribs cook for one hour without opening the lid.
  6. Check ribs and if they are not done, cook for another 30 minutes.
  7. When they are just starting to fall apart, slather with barbecue sauce. Cook 3 minutes, turn and slather the other side. Cook just until ribs have a nice color and sauce is glazed.
  8. Serve ribs as whole rack, or cut between each rib bone and pile individually on a platter.
Notes

Tip from porkbeinspired.com: for incredibly tender ribs: After cooking, remove ribs from grill, wrap securely in heavy aluminum foil. Place foil-wrapped ribs in brown paper bags, close bags and let ribs rest for up to 1 hour. Finish getting the rest of your meal together and have some extra sauce on the table.
